Are people in Elizabethtown older or younger than people in Celina?
- The Median Age in Elizabethtown is 14.9 years younger than in Celina.

Are housing costs cheaper in Elizabethtown or Celina?
- Elizabethtown housing costs are 80.5% more expensive than Celina hous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Elizabethtown or Celina?
- The average commute for residents of Elizabethtown is 7.2 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Celina.

Things to do in Elizabethtown?
Elizabethtown, PA sits in Lancaster county boasting a population close to 13,000 people. This small town features plenty of attractions such as its historical covered bridge or Elizabethtown College with scenic views on its beautiful campus. Visitors here may also enjoy recreational activities like golfing at Spooky Nook Sports Complex or biking at Susquehanna Trail offering plenty of nature along its trail route!
